About mid-eighties, El Salvador was involved in a severe and criminal disagreement, that have protests, kidnappings, attacks, seizures out-of church buildings, and you may dying squads, you to definitely sent the nation to the disorder having effects around the several establishments within this neighborhood. This era watched a good amount of specialized appeal change out-of social groups into assistance and financial support from armed forces pushes. Furthermore, but the majority of outlying organizations nationwide suffered shelling and you will army confrontations you to definitely triggered damaged schools, blocking children out of browsing category and you may making of several instructors reluctant to accept posts when you look at the schools in conflict areas. Ever since then, the education system possess experienced reform who may have seen grand improvements. People today are able to get the consistent for free, they discover a glass of whole milk every single day, and also the standard shelter out of institutional support is a lot stronger. Obviously, you may still find of several conditions that have to be beat, one of which is the equality out of academic potential anywhere between boys and you can girls.

On account Japansk dating -app of a society away from houses getting run because of the a lady as number 1 earnings comes from the person, the education regarding girls in Este Salvador try unfortuitously continuously small-existed. The pressure getting girls in order to dump formal studies during the an early decades to greatly help at your home is normal among household both in outlying and you will cities, whenever you are boys are expected to remain in college to possess an extended time. Typically, the amount of time invested of the Salvadorean students in school try just four years; having boys averaging cuatro.6 age and you can girls step three.cuatro decades, often due to moving house, switching schools, otherwise, particularly, being required to go homeward which help inside the home-based-fields jobs. That it request when deciding to take up obligations in the home away from for example a keen early age leaves girls from the a direct drawback – their education try halted when you find yourself their male equivalents have the opportunity to continue learning, expanding their odds of seeking some other career.

No matter if these types of statistics was molded toward a national peak, he is obviously represented here in Santa Catarina Masahuat. Of 2,202 residential property here, simply 21 % is actually on course by feminine once the high earner – that produces the newest local government third in the bottom in the nation regarding the number of feminine provided houses. With respect to studies, fewer than half of these brains of property went to a center to get certified education, and not one was in fact claimed to own concluded studying at a beneficial technical school (polytechnic) otherwise college. Even with reformed the education system recently, outlying regions of the country such as Santa Catarina was needless to say however not able to provide chance to the town, which means that for most household the brand new extent of the elite occupation could well be restricted towards the community which they was in fact produced into the.

Similarly, the pressure first off a family on a young age was including just as commonplace – it has been known for pupils as early as twelve to help you be sexually active on account of household members points one to remind this sort out of liberty

You will find all in all, 11 schools in the Santa Catarina Masahuat, 1 in the newest urban area and ten from the rural section. The school in town is the just one run because of the Public Relationship from Education and is one that i continuously visit to give discussions with the youth rights, female liberties and you can sexual fitness, and it is the fresh venue for the latest overall performance out of Romeo and Juliet. According to the youthfulness coverage advised of the MIJUDEM (Mesa Integrated Juvenil – the youth group the opportunity try supporting), from inside the Santa Catarina typically, ninety five per cent of kids complete first education; 98 % from boys and you can 86 per cent away from girls.

Furthermore, twenty six % of the town you should never read or generate, away from and this, 370 try someone amongst the chronilogical age of ten and you will 29; 117 is men and 253 is actually women. Even though this matter is apparently very reasonable, it is still much better than the new federal average of 30 for every single penny not being able to discover or create. It’s guaranteeing to see the prosperity of the education program in Santa Catarina, especially when as compared to national averages. New abandonment out-of training off girls is probably outside the control out-of education organizations, and you may domestic challenges merely overrule in the organizations the spot where the consult to help you uphold a great quality lifestyle is not as easy as it’s someplace else.
